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
006[ Solid metal targets and metal alloys for use in the fields of sputtering and arc evaporation for coating substrates ]SECTION 71 - CANCELLED
007Vacuum treatment machines for treating the surface of tools and components such as heating, cleaning, and coating with layers in a vacuum; machines for cleaning a surface using plasma in the nature of vacuum chambers, arc evaporators, vacuum separators, sputtering machines, plasma treatment devices, and parts and components thereforACTIVE
040Surface coating of machined pieces, particularly with non-organic coatings and coverings such as hard coatings, layers of metal, ceramic-metal coatings and diamond coatingsACTIVE
